Output ef8a924598bc129ec163a95ec16569fdf57a2250894c20a0365511712409f23b:0

value
740007
script pubkey
OP_HASH160 OP_PUSHBYTES_20 dabaa29e9aff4f56b71048a38c6abda6c0e5e8c8 OP_EQUAL
address
3MdYp1JjAYsdn1UxdbarmQaj7uc9gi5dz2
transaction
ef8a924598bc129ec163a95ec16569fdf57a2250894c20a0365511712409f23b
spent
true